One-Pan Baked Chicken and Veggies: Minimal Cleanup, Maximum Flavor

This easy one-pan meal is a lifesaver on busy evenings. The chicken and veggies cook together, absorbing each other's flavors, leaving you with a balanced, flavorful meal that requires minimal cleanup.

Ingredients:

  • 4 chicken thighs
  • 2 cups baby potatoes (halved)
  • 1 cup baby carrots
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h rosemary (optional)

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Toss the potatoes and carrots with olive oil,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Place on a baking sheet.
  3. Add the chicken thighs to the sheet and season them with the same mixture.
  4.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until the chicken is fully cooked. Garnish with fresh rosemary and serve.

15-Minute Shrimp Stir-Fry: A Quick, Healthy Option

For seafood lovers, this shrimp stir-fry is an ideal weeknight meal. It's light, nutritious, and ready in just 15 minutes, perfect for those nights when you need dinner on the table fast.

Ingredients:

  • 1 lb shrimp (peeled and deveined)
  • 1 cup mixed vegetables (broccoli, bell peppers, snap peas)
  • 1 tbsp soy sauce
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 clove garlic (minced)
  • Cooked rice for serving

Instructions:

  1. Heat olive oil in a large pan, add minced garlic, and sauté for 1 minute.
  2. Add shrimp and stir-fry until pink and cooked through (about 3 minutes).
  3. Toss in mixed vegetables and soy sauce, cooking for another 5-7 minutes until veggies are tender.
  4. Serve over rice for a complete meal.

Spaghetti Aglio e Olio: A Classic Italian Delight in Minutes

This simple Italian dish relies on pantry staples like pasta, garlic, and olive oil to create a delicious meal in under 20 minutes. It's perfect for busy weeknights when you need something quick yet satisfying.

Ingredients:

  • 8 oz spaghetti
  • 4 cloves garlic (sliced)
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 1 tsp red pepper flakes (optional)
  • Fresh parsley (for garnish)
  • Grated Parmesan cheese

Instructions:

  1. Cook spaghetti according to package instructions.
  2. In a large pan, heat olive oil and sauté sliced garlic until golden brown.
  3. Add red pepper flakes and cooked pasta to the pan, tossing to coat.
  4. Garnish with parsley and Parmesan before serving.

Taco Salad: A Fresh, Fast Meal for Taco Lovers

Taco salad is a fun and quick way to enjoy the flavors of tacos without the extra mess. It’s light, customizable, and ready in no time.

Ingredients:

  • 1 lb ground beef or turkey
  • 1 packet taco seasoning
  • 4 cups lettuce (chopped)
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es (halved)
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heese
  • Tortilla chips for topping
  • Salsa and sour cream for dressing

Instructions:

  1. Cook the ground meat in a skillet and season with taco seasoning.
  2. Assemble the salad by layering lettuce, tomatoes, cheese, and cooked meat.
  3. Top with tortilla chips, salsa, and sour cream.

Cheesy Broccoli Rice Casserole: Comfort Food in a Flash

This cheesy casserole is hearty and comforting, making it a great choice for those busy evenings when you need something warm and filling. It's also a great way to sneak in some extra veggies!

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ups cooked rice
  • 2 cups broccoli florets (steamed)
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 tbsp butter
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a large bowl, mix the cooked rice, steamed broccoli, cheese, milk, and butter. Season with salt and pepper.
  3. Transfer to a baking dish and bake for 10-12 minutes until the cheese is melted and bubbly.

Pita Bread Pizzas: Quick and Customizable

When you're short on time but still craving pizza, pita bread pizzas are a fun, fast solution. They allow for endless customization with toppings and can be made in under 15 minutes.

Ingredients:

  • 4 pita breads
  • 1 cup marinara sauce
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
  • Toppings of your choice (pepperoni, veggies, etc.)

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Spread marinara sauce on each pita bread, followed by cheese and toppings.
  3. Bake for 8-10 minutes until the cheese is melted and golden. Serve immediately.

Chicken Caesar Wraps: A Fast, Fresh Dinner

Chicken Caesar wraps are an easy and refreshing dinner option that you can put together in just minutes. Perfect for warmer evenings or when you need something light yet satisfying.

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ups cooked chicken (shredded)
  • 4 large tortillas
  • 1/4 cup Caesar dressing
  • 2 cups romaine lettuce (chopped)
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ese

Instructions:

  1. Toss the shredded chicken with Caesar dressing.
  2. Lay the tortillas flat, and layer with lettuce, chicken, and Parmesan cheese.
  3. Roll up the wraps and serve immediately.
